Apprenticeship Engagement and ESIC Coverage

Generally, establishments engage two sets of apprentices:
1st - As per the standing order or the establishment's own recruitment policy.
2nd - Under the Apprentices Act, 1961, for which a quota of apprentices has been fixed by the authority. The 1st set is covered under the ESIC Act. However, the 2nd set is not covered under the ESIC, and to cover their risk, it is preferable to obtain an EC policy against them.
